The top of the cylinder's edge is several V-shaped valleys. Each valley represents a different depth, and the combination of all valleys encodes a code that corresponds to the pins of the cylinder. The key can only rotate the cylinder if the valleys are in the correct order.

If you've never used locks before, it may seem complicated to figure out how it operates. Once you've mastered the basics, you'll discover that it's really quite simple. First, you must find the key's warding design. This is a form that restricts the keys that be used to fit inside the lock's keyway. The stop is usually located in the middle of the blade, however on certain keys, the tip is employed instead.

The pins move up and down when you insert the key in the lock. If you insert the correct key, the pins align with the shearline. If the shear line is unlocked the cylinder will turn and unlock the lock. If the shear line is blocked, the cylinder won't turn, and you'll have to try again using a different key.

Many cars have a transponder key which uses an induction coil that sends an electrical signal to the vehicle's receiver. When the key is inserted into the ignition, the receiver receives the signal and reads the identification number from the transponder. The engine will start if the number matches that of the car's serial number. In addition, some cars have an immobilizer that prevents the engine from starting without an active transponder.
